Jobs for CAD/CADD Drafting Technology Grads in New Mexico

In this state, there are 840 people employed in jobs related to a CAD/CADD Drafting Tech degree, compared to 185,480 nationwide.

Wages for CAD/CADD Drafting Technology Jobs in New Mexico

A typical salary for a CAD/CADD Drafting Tech grad in the state is $74,249, compared to a typical salary of $70,755 nationwide.

CAD/CADD Drafting Technology Careers in NM

Some of the careers CAD/CADD Drafting Tech majors go into include:

Job Title Nationwide Job Growth Nationwide Median Salary
Architectural and Civil Drafters 14% $82,779
Mechanical Drafters 13% $78,252
Electrical and Electronics Drafters 12% $109,781
Drafters, All Other -1% $114,777
